Quote:
Speaking with Entertainment Tonight at the premiere for The Marvels, Feige was asked about the future of the X-Men considering his own teases about their involvement in the Marvel Cinematic Universe but also the teases we've already gotten (Ms. Marvel previously teased Kamala Khan would be a mutant rather than an Inhuman). "I dont know if it's delicate, it's super exciting, but the X-Men are as solid and rich and great a concept and characters that exist. (There's) the return of the animated series next year, which we're very excited about. I saw some new final episodes today which really bring you back to that core of who the X-Men are and that soap opera that those characters represent. And in live-action, people will see....perhaps, soon."
